While Preston Park station might not have all the bells and whistles of a major train terminal, it does offer essential facilities for travelers. The ticket office is open from 06:00 to 19:10 on weekdays and Saturdays, with shorter hours on Sundays. Ticket machines are available and equipped to assist those using a Disabled Persons Railcard. Though automated, assistance from staff is also accessible during similar hours.
Preston Park's accessibility features include an induction loop, and assistance can be facilitated via help points across platforms. The station lacks step-free access, a detail that may need consideration for those with mobility challenges. There's a distinct seating area available for passengers seeking comfort while waiting for trains.

Bursledon Station may be compact, but it hosts essential facilities for your travel needs. Although there is no staffed ticket office, ticket machines are available to collect pre-purchased tickets or buy new ones. These machines are user-friendly and cater to travelers with accessibility needs, offering discounts for those with a Disabled Persons Railcard. The station does not have a waiting room or refreshment facilities, and you won't find toilets or baby changing areas here.
For those needing assistance, Bursledon has help points and departure screens with announcements. However, there is no staff assistance available on-site, so it's advisable to plan ahead if you require help. Finally, bicycle storage facilities with six available spaces cater to cyclists, though there are no options for cycle hire.
Bursledon Station provides links to various modes of transportation. There is a rail replacement bus service available when needed, with stops conveniently located on A27/Bridge Road.
